The dividend yield percentage is an important metric used by investors to evaluate the income-generating capacity of a stock or ETF, relative to its present market price. It is determined as: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ac \ text Annual Dividends per Share \ text Existing Market Price per Share \ right) \ times 100]
For instance, if SCHD pays an annual dividend of ₤ 1.50, and its present market value is ₤ 75, the dividend yield would be: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ac 1.50 75 \ right) \ times 100 = 2.00%]
This suggests that for every single dollar bought SCHD, a financier might anticipate to earn a 2.00% return in the type of dividends.

Aspects Affecting SCHD's Dividend Yield Percentage
Market Value Volatility: The market rate of SCHD shares can vary due to numerous elements, consisting of total market sentiment and economic conditions. A decline in market value, with consistent dividends, can increase the dividend yield percentage.

Dividend Payout Changes: Changes in the actual dividends declared by SCHD can directly affect the dividend yield. An increase in dividends will usually increase the yield, while a reduction will lower it.

Rate Of Interest Environment: The more comprehensive rates of interest environment plays a considerable role. When rates of interest are low, yield-seeking investors typically flock to dividend-paying stocks and ETFs, increasing their costs and yielding a lower percentage.
